The Darker Side of Computer Recycling

Makarand writes "We all know that with electronics it is very difficult to be green. We leave our computer waste in the recyle bin lest dangerous chemicals like lead and mercury seep into our landfills. The more dedicated environmentalists make a trip to the local recyling center where they may be asked around to pay around $15-$30 to recycle their old PCs. But guess what -- these 'recyclers' merely ship 50-80% of this stuff overseas. The Mercury News has a report on this ugly side of the PC industry which merely exports the recycling problems instead of solving them."

    There was a recent Guardian article about how Kazakhstan was looking towards importing European nuclear waste as a way of rescuing their economy. The company planning this expects to use abandoned uranium mines; the company president was quoted as
    We get $10 for extracting a cubic metre of uranium. We would get $100 to deposit the same amount of nuclear waste.
    (I think he meant extracting uranium ore- $10/ m^3 is a very good price for uranium...)


    It makes more sense when you realize that they already have their own huge radioactive disposal problem, and the marginal cost of a little bit more disposal is much less than what other, far more crowded European countries would be willing to pay to get it off their hands. They are the ninth largest country in the world with a population of 16 million, so there is significantly more room for waste disposal than in nearby Western Europe, which may be the region in the world most sensitive to waste disposal concerns of all kinds.

    Just as in other environmental decisions, there are immediate and long-term goals that need to be balanced. Economic factors affect these decisions- an affluent community would rather have an expensive recycling facility, whereas an impoverished community would think it is nuts to spend big bucks on that and would go with the cheaper, traditional solution of a town dump, complete with perpetual tire-fire. These decisions are motivated by economic factors- given ample resources, most everyone would prefer a cleaner environment. But not everyone is willing to pay for it, so there ends up being disparity between decisions that affect the environment based upon local economic conditions.

    Internationally, this comes as third-world countries which are happy to exchange cleaner air for lower-cost production which allows essential economic growth. Presumably, residents (or at least political representatives of residents) value the immediate economic boon over the long-term consequences. In the case of disposal, since there are already large waste-disposal issues of their own, the marginal cost of slightly larger waste-disposal issues apparently is outweighed by the massive price other countries would be willing to pay to get it off their hands. Unfortunately, decisions like these (trading in a long-term cost for a short-term benefit), are often political, and political decisions rarely favor long-term sustainable policies over short-term boons.

    From the article it seems that the worst problem isn't the material in the computer. It's the dangerous chemicals used to treat the waste -- for instance soaking the motherboard in a strong acid to extract gold and other valuables. Likewise, the cable coatings may not be that harmful per se, but the method of burning them to extract the copper will probably produce harmful compounds.

    Its too bad the Merc was too busy spreading the bad news to spread a little good news as well.

    Alameda Country Computer Resource Center is an excellent program, about 30 minutes from the Mercury's office, recycles and reuses, and installs Linux on much of what passes through their doors, and ships what they can't use to a special facility in Canada where it is smelted for valuable ores. (and no it doesn't get dumped in Canada, they have stricter laws about that kind of thing then we do)

    Also they only charge $10 for computer drop off not $30, and accept a number of items for free. They publish a schedule of fees on their website.
